Thomas Ørdal Maale (born 22 October 1974) is a Danish former footballer and physical coach at HB Køge.

He played for a number of Danish clubs including Lyngby BK, Fremad Amager and Hvidovre IF.

In July 2008 he was named new manager of Glostrup FK. He continued as manager of the club, after it merged with Albertslund IF in 2009 to form BGA.

In July 2011 he succeeded Freddy Andersen as manager of Nordvest FC. He left the club in 2013 in order to become physical coach at HB Køge.
